Expressão das metaloproteinases de matriz 2 e 9 em cães com linfoma: associação com fatores prognósticos

Abstract

O linfoma é uma doença linfoproliferativa caracterizada pela multiplicação clonal de linfócitos malignos no seio dos órgãos linfóides, afetando principalmente os linfonodos, ou outros órgãos viscerais sólidos, com prognóstico dependente de vários fatores, incluindo invasão tecidual. Enzimas proteolíticas MMP-2 e MMP-9 estão sendo estudadas quanto à importância neste processo de progressão tumoral por propiciarem a penetração e infiltração celular. Considerando a importância atual destas enzimas e o papel ainda não fundamentado nas neoplasias hematopoiéticas, avaliou-se a expressão de MMP-2 e MMP-9 em cães acometidos por linfoma multicêntrico e cães hígidos, através de técnica imuno-histoquimica de linfonodo e eletroforese zimográfica de linfonodo e soro, estabelecendo a relação entre a expressão destas enzimas e os fatores prognósticos como estadiamento, imunofenotipo e grau histopatológico da neoplasia e resposta ao tratamento. Observou-se maior expressão tecidual de MMP-9 nos animais com linfoma, através de técnica imuno-histoquimica, sem correlação exata com prognóstico. Eletroforese zimográfica do linfonodo demonstrou correlação da MMP-9 com imunofenótipo T e animais em doença progressiva, inferindo possível prognóstico negativo quanto à sobrevida. Valores de MMP-2 não apresentaram relação clara com o processo tumoral, assim como os valores séricos das duas enzimas. Desta forma, a MMP-9 demonstrou participação no processo neoplásico, porém sem determinação prognóstica exata

Lymphoma is a lymphoproliferative disease characterized by clonal proliferation of malignant lymphocytes within lymphoid organs, mainly affecting the lymph nodes, or other solid visceral organs, with prognosis depends on several factors, including tissue invasion. Proteolytic enzymes MMP-2 and MMP-9 have been studied as to the importance of tumor progression in this process by propitiate the penetration and cellular infiltration. Considering the current importance of these enzymes and the role not grounded in hematopoietic malignancies, we evaluated the expression of MMP-2 and MMP-9 in dogs affected by multicentric lymphoma and healthy dogs by immunohistochemistry technique of lymph node and zymography electrophoresis of lymph node and serum, establishing the relationship between the expression of these enzymes and prognostic factors such as tumor staging, immunophenotyping, histological grade and response to treatment. We observed increased expression of MMP-9 tissue in animals with lymphoma by immunohistochemistry technique, no exact correlation with prognosis. Zymography electrophoresis of lymph node demonstrated correlation of MMP-9 with T-cell phenotype and progressive disease, inferring possible negative prognosis regarding survival. Values of MMP-2 showed no clear relation with the tumoral process as well as serum levels of the two enzymes. Thus, MMP-9 demonstrated involvement in the neoplastic process, but without accurate prognostic determination
